520 _aAnalysis in De Montfort University's 2010 report on the lending patterns of 59 large-scale commercial property lenders operating within the UK for the year ending 31 December 2009 shows banks are back in the commercial lending business but are only just recognising the extent of the legacy problems from lending strategies in the previous boom. Total property lending to commercial property and social housing reached £247.7bn and outstanding bank debt secured by UK commercial property rose by 1.2% to £228 3bn in 2009, the lowest increase on record. The total market size is now estimated to be as large as £306bn.
